I have complained with the Mellieħa local council regarding Għadira Bay many times. The two contractors with a beach concession have this year gone a step further: the space for us poor tax payers is even smaller than last year’s.

This apart from the fact that this year the lifeguard post has become a small maisonette, right in the middle of the bay adjacent to San Remo Restaurant. I fully agree with a lifeguard post in such a populated bay but did it have to be that big?

I have nothing against the beach contractors but I think it’s ridiculous to have to pay up to €20 for an umbrella and two sunbeds. Does the blue flag status take this into consideration as well? I personally cannot afford this every Sunday.

Councillors and beach supervisors, please note! Għadira Bay is not Rimini. We live in Malta not Italy where the beaches are run by contractors. Please do not forget us poor natives!
